One year ago we lost the "Godfather of Downtown". We remember Davis' passion for and commitment to the redevelopment of Downtown Baton Rouge over the last 34 years was a spark that ignited a fire in the community, and the results of that vision can be seen on every corner. His enthusiasm was contagious and his ability to bring people together to effect change was a special gift that is greatly missed and not easily replaced.
The DDD has moved forward with heavy hearts, and will continue the effort to make downtown and the greater community a vibrant and outstanding place to live and work.
In October of 2021 the City of Baton Rouge honored Davis' lifelong commitment to the City by dedicating the greenspace "Rhorer Plaza" in his name. Learn more about his beloved downtown greenspace below.
